TWO GOOD TALKIES.

“ Smoke Lightning ” and “Men are Such Fools.” Two good talkies—a drama, ” Men Are Such Fools,” and a Western, ” Smoke Lightning ’’—are offered at the Liberty Theatre this week. Certainly Tons' Mello, the chief character in “ Men Are Such Fools,” played with feeling, humour and intelligence by Leo Carrillo, was a fool to love his wife, Lili (Vivienne Osborne) so much. She married him only because she thought he would become famous, and could bring- equal fame to her—and then she left him. Carrillo is undoubtedly the greatest exponent of the Latin type at present in films. Others in the cast are Una Merkel, a girl friend. Tom Moore, a kindly plainclothes policeman, and Joseph Cawthorn, who gives one of his humorous German characterisations. George O’Brien is featured in “ Smoke Lightning.” a new type of Western adapted from Zane Grey’s novel. “Canyon Walls.” O’Brien is excellently cast as the cowboy, and adds to his already long list of successes. Frank Atkinson is really funny as Alf. and Betsy King Ross does sqme good work as the rancher’s daughter. The feminine lead is taken by Nell O'Day.
